Affinity-based chromatography is a powerful and specific separation method used for bioactive compound isolation and purification employing the binding affinity between immune complexes. Specific monoclonal antibodies or patient immunoglobulin have been used to capture human or mouse tumor tissue-derived antigens, HLA-restricted tumor-specific antigens, and neoantigens. Following the capture process, the proteins bound to chromatography are eluted and evaluated by various other methods. ✔ Antigen Protein Purification
Antigen protein could be purified from two pathways, immunoaffinity chromatography, and receptor-ligand-based affinity chromatography assay.
High-specificity monoclonal antibodies are used to purify antigens based on binding affinity.

A variety of methods are supplied to immobilize and couple antibodies to the matrix with the right direction and site.
The effective elution conditions ensure antigen peptides elute from the column and keep the column easy for regeneration.

Biotinylated monoclonal antibodies are incubated with the antigen protein mixture, and the formed antigen-antibody complex is purified by an avidin column. Finally, the bound antigens are separated using a proper elution buffer.

✔ Antigen-antibody Complex Purification
SEC, also known as gel filtration chromatography, is widely used to collect highly purified, homogeneous antigen-antibody complex from a mixture based on molecule size.
✔ Techniques and Assays for Epitope Peptide Analysis
The eluted antigen binders can be used to immunize animals to acquire antisera and then examined by multiple assays.
Amino Acid Sequencing: Liquid chromatography and mass spectrometry assay.
Purity Tests: Immunoprecipitation assay and SDS-PAGE.
Specificity Tests: Western blot, ELISA, and antibody mediated cross blocking assay.
3D Structure study: X-ray crystallization, small-angle scattering, and nuclear magnetic resonance (NMR) assay.
